overlived

/ˌoʊvərˈlɪvd/
verb
  1. Past tense and past participle of overlive: lived longer than; survived beyond.
    • She overlived her siblings by decades.
    • He had overlived his usefulness in the old company.
    • The legend says the king overlived all his enemies.
